Model Evolution and Rare Editions: From Factory Fresh to Ultra-Unique
Brabus, founded in 1977 in Bottrop, Germany, has focused for decades on building the most outrageous versions of Mercedes-Benz models. However, the transformation isn’t just about more horsepower. For example, take the Brabus 900 Rocket Edition based on the Mercedes-AMG G63—this SUV rockets from 0-100km/h in just over 3 seconds.
Meanwhile, Brabus has built a legendary reputation on rare builds. Models like the Brabus G V12 900, of which only 10 examples exist, command prices high above standard AMG models. In contrast, even “base” Brabus G-Class or E-Class sedans offer significant upgrades.
Therefore, each Brabus build carries distinct appeal. Some represent the only one ever made, while others are limited runs. Similarly, Brabus 800 Adventure XLP trucks or S-Class Brabus 900s each take the original Mercedes and elevate it in power and exclusivity.

How Much Does a Mercedes Brabus Cost?
The cost for Brabus models is arguably their most intriguing aspect. Depending on the donor car (G-Class, S-Class, E-Class, etc.), Brabus pricing can be eye-watering—often leaving even top AMG models behind. However, these price tags represent more than just performance mods.
- Brabus G63 700/800/900: In many markets, expect to pay $350,000–$700,000+.
- Brabus S-Class 800/900: Prices often push well above $500,000, especially with custom interiors.
- Brabus Adventure XLP: These wild pickups are among the rarest, often exceeding $600,000 for top specs.
- One-off and Limited Editions: Unique builds like the G V12 900 or super-limited 850/900 coupes can eclipse $1 million.
In comparison, a top AMG G63 may cost around $200,000, but a full Brabus conversion almost doubles—or even triples—the price. Moreover, the included engineering, build quality, and rarity drive the cost higher.
Brabus vs. the Best from Rival Brands
When stacking Brabus against brands like Mansory, ABT, or even Rolls-Royce Black Badge, certain advantages stand out. For example, Brabus offers full OEM-level warranties for their upgrades, making ownership less stressful.
- Reliability: Brabus rigorously tests every vehicle.
- Power: Horsepower figures leave most rivals in the dust.
- Luxury: No one matches the quality of bespoke interiors from Brabus.
- Presence: The Brabus badge conveys rare status even among exotic owners.
Furthermore, unlike many tuners, Brabus works in close partnership with Mercedes-Benz—ensuring factory-quality results and long-term value. Meanwhile, the resale value for Brabus editions, especially rare ones, tends to be higher than most bespoke rivals. Consequently, collectors often seek top-spec Brabus builds for their portfolios.
